At the 2008 annual symposium of Urshan Graduate School of Theology, Brother David K. Bernard offered a fuller commentary on footwashing in a presentation on holiness and culture. He made the argument that "if one believes Jesus’ command to observe Communion was to be followed, so we must also follow His directive for footwashing."
